程序如何判断服务器在哪个机架上?

HDFS默认对一个block有三个副本,第一个副本和第2和3副本存在在不同的机架上,HDFS是如何确定的呢?

附言 1  ·  10个月前

这个问题已经解决了。
就是HDFS会对每个机架的ID进行处理,简单来说就是HDFS会对每个机器的IP前缀进行判断,一致就被当做在同一个机架上

讨论数量: 0
(= ̄ω ̄=)··· 暂无内容!

讨论应以学习和精进为目的。请勿发布不友善或者负能量的内容,与人为善,比聪明更重要!